In this episode of Zion’s Ancient Paths, we explore the true meaning of marriage through the lens of Ancient Hebrew culture and Scripture. From the betrothal of Rebecca, to Israel’s covenant at Mount Sinai, to Yahuah adorning His bride with fine linen and jewels, marriage has always been more than a contract—it is a covenant.
We’ll compare these ancient truths with the Roman and Western ideals we’ve inherited today, and consider what we as Israelites must reclaim in our marriages and our covenant walk with Yahuah.
